GNU/Linux >> Tutoriels Linux >  >> Linux

Comment modifier l'ID de machine d'un système dans Oracle Enterprise Linux 7

Demander  :Un système a le même ID de machine que celui d'origine, il faut le différencier pour que certaines applications puissent distinguer les systèmes.

Qu'est-ce que l'identifiant de la machine ?

– Le /etc/machine-id Le fichier contient l'ID d'ordinateur unique du système local défini lors de l'installation. L'ID d'ordinateur est une chaîne d'ID d'ordinateur minuscule, hexadécimale, de 32 caractères et terminée par une nouvelle ligne. Lorsqu'il est décodé à partir de l'hexadécimal, cela correspond à une chaîne de 16 octets/128 bits.
– Le paramètre "machine-id" est ajouté à partir de RHEL 7.1 pour identifier la machine dans le réseau. Par conséquent, ce paramètre doit être unique.
– Mais lorsque l'utilisateur clone la machine virtuelle sur laquelle RHEL 7.1 est installé, « l'ID de machine » de la machine virtuelle clonée n'est pas modifié et certaines machines virtuelles peuvent avoir le même « ID de machine ». ”.
– L'utilisateur doit modifier le "machine-id" de la machine virtuelle clonée pour que le serveur soit identifiable de manière unique sur le réseau.
– Le machine-id est écrit dans le fichier /etc/machine- identifiant.

Il existe un outil intégré dans systemd appelé systemd-machine-id-setup qui permettra la re-génération de la machine-id. Voici la procédure d'utilisation :

1. Ajoutez une autorisation d'écriture au fichier d'identification de la machine :

# chmod 777 /etc/machine-id

2. Ouvrez /etc/machine-id avec un éditeur de texte et supprimez tout son contenu.

# vi /etc/machine-id

3. Renommez le fichier /etc/machine-id :

# mv /etc/machine-id /etc/machine-id.oldid

4. Exécutez la commande :

# systemd-machine-id-setup 

5. Restaurez les autorisations précédentes du fichier :

# chmod 444 /etc/machine-id

Maintenant, le système aura des identifiants différents.


Linux
  1. Comment changer les paramètres régionaux du système sur RHEL7 Linux

  2. Comment changer un niveau d'exécution sur le système RHEL 7 Linux

  3. Comment vérifier si un système Linux est une machine physique ou virtuelle

  4. Comment reconfigurer Oracle 10g xe sous Linux

  5. Comment changer la date de Linux en UTC/GMT +1 ?

Comment définir ou modifier le nom d'hôte sous Linux

Comment changer le shell par défaut dans le système Linux

Comment protéger par mot de passe GRUB2 dans Oracle Enterprise Linux 7

Comment configurer kdump dans Oracle Enterprise Linux (OEL 5,6)

Comment changer le nom d'utilisateur et le nom d'hôte sur le système Linux

Dans mon fichier /etc/hosts/ sous Linux/OSX, comment créer un sous-domaine générique ?